Ancient Crete & The Minoans: Fountains

Ancient Crete & Minoans: Fountains 46938417583471753687.jpg Ancient Crete & The Minoans: Fountains A variety of kinds of conduits have been uncovered through archaeological digs on the isle of Crete, the cradle of Minoan civilization. In conjunction with offering water, they dispersed water that accumulated from deluges or waste. The principle components employed were rock or terracotta. Terracotta was selected for canals and pipes, both rectangular and spherical. There are two examples of Minoan terracotta pipes, those with a shortened cone form and a U-shape that have not been caught in any civilization ever since. Terracotta water lines were laid below the flooring at Knossos Palace and utilized to distribute water. The piping also had other functions such as collecting water and directing it to a central place for storing. Thus, these pipes had to be ready to: Underground Water Transportation: This obscure system for water movement may have been used to give water to certain individuals or occasions. Quality Water Transportation: Bearing in mind the data, several historians propose that these pipes were not connected to the common water delivery process, supplying the residence with water from a various source.

Choose from all Types of External Fountains

Choose from all Types of External Fountains Is it possible for you to convert your yard into a haven of serenity? The calming feeling provided by outdoor fountains is just one of the benefits of including a water feature in your garden.Choose Types External Fountains 7939893098.jpg

The beauty of a spouting fountain can be seen when it propels a stream of shooting water into the air. If your pond is sufficiently big, it can be incorporated without trouble. Esplanades and traditional stately homes often have one these water features.

Outdoor water features are available in varied forms, one of which is a chic wall fountain. Such water features make for a great addition to your yard even if it is small. Wall fountains are not flashy water features when compared with a spouting fountain. In this simple process. the water which is pushed out of a small opening, flows down a beautifully textured wall and is then collected at the base before being pumped back to the top.

Dependent on the style you have chosen for the garden, you could think about a themed fountain. If your cottage or garden is styled in a rustic manner, you should think about adding a classic type of statue, such as a seraph holding the spout, to your fountain. Consider including something bolder and unique for a contemporary garden. Feel free to let your hair down and pick something interesting and audacious.

Tiered fountains are unique because the water flows down multiple levels. Cascading fountains is another name used to identify this type of fountain because water streams down multiple levels.

The space required for an outdoor fountain can be vast, therefore, a better alternative is to install a wall fountain or a pondless fountain. The reservoirs necessary for these kinds of fountains are hidden underground which helps you better use your limited space.

If you seek a feeling of peacefulness and calmness, put in a Japanese fountain as these are thought to bring about such sensations. Bamboo sticks function as the piping from which water flows in these kinds of water features. Water then streams into a recipient or a shaped stone, only to repeat the pattern over and over again.

An additional style of fountain is made of glass. Creating a more classical appearance are trellis-style fountains which feature shaped metalwork. Water features of this type are an excellent alternative for gardens with many sharp edges along with contemporary forms and design. As the water flows over the top of the glass it produces a dazzling impact. LED lighting fixtures are also utilized in some fountains to flash color across the water as it flows down on the glass sheet. A rock waterfall fountain (often made of imitation rock) showcases water slowly cascading down its façade.

The feature which differentiates a bubbling rock fountain is a large rock drilled with holes where pipes can be inserted into its center. In this type of fountain, water is pushed upwards at low pressure to cause it to bubble and gurgle at the top. Water then flows as a gentle trickle down the sides of the rock to its base. Gardens with limited space are good areas to include this style of fountain. To ensure that water is not sprayed around if it starts to get windy, this kind of fountain is the best option since it only uses low pressure to move water.

Solar fountains have recently gained in popularity because they are powered by sunlight. The reasons for this are diverse, from the absence of wires and the reduced complexities to the lower power bills and the beneficial impact on our environment. You will not have to concede on style since there is a wide selection of designs to choose from in outdoor solar-powered fountains.

The Godfather Of Rome's Fountains

The Godfather Of Rome's Fountains There are countless celebrated Roman water fountains in its city center. Pretty much all of them were designed, architected and built by one of the finest sculptors and artists of the 17th century, Gian Lorenzo Bernini. Also a city builder, he had capabilities as a water fountain designer, and remnants of his life's work are evident throughout the avenues of Rome.Godfather Rome's Fountains 2448647547797500626.jpg Bernini's father, a renowned Florentine sculptor, mentored his young son, and they ultimately moved to Rome, in order to fully express their art, primarily in the form of public water fountains and water features. An excellent employee, the young Bernini received praise and patronage of various popes and influential designers. His sculpture was initially his claim to celebrity. Most notably in the Vatican, he utilized a base of knowledge in historical Greek architecture and melded it seamlessly with Roman marble. Though many artists impacted his artistic endeavors, Michelangelo inspired him the most.

Back Story of Outdoor Fountains

Back Story Outdoor Fountains 22867402024237159600.jpg Back Story of Outdoor Fountains Hundreds of classic Greek documents were translated into Latin under the authority of the scholarly Pope Nicholas V, who led the Roman Catholic Church from 1397 to 1455. He undertook the embellishment of Rome to make it into the worthy seat of the Christian world. At the bidding of the Pope, the Aqua Vergine, a damaged aqueduct which had carried clean drinking water into Rome from eight miles away, was reconditioned starting in 1453. The ancient Roman tradition of marking the arrival point of an aqueduct with an magnificent celebratory fountain, also known as a mostra, was restored by Nicholas V. The architect Leon Battista Alberti was commissioned by the Pope to construct a wall fountain where we now find the Trevi Fountain. The Trevi Fountain as well as the well-known baroque fountains located in the Piazza del Popolo and the Piazza Navona were eventually supplied with water from the altered aqueduct he had reconstructed.
